Cleveland doesn't deserve this team? Ummm, learn some history. The city sold out 455 straight games when they had an ownership group that spent the money to actually compete. The Dolans spent $360 mil on the team which left them cash poor as far as a pro sports ownership group is concerned, the team has more than doubled in value since and they continually cry about attendance after trading two consecutive Cy Young award winners and then cry to the media that they "will spend more when more people come to the games". Speaking out of both sides of their mouth, blaming the fans for their own shortcomings and then selling off their best players before having to actually pay them market value. I have said for years that the team will never win it all with the Dolans as owners. Are there worse owners out there? Sure, but saying the city doesn't deserve the team is an ignorant statement.
